摘要
A dual band monopole resonator antenna is proposed in this paper. The antenna works at two different bands with central frequencies of 2.4 GHz and 5 GHz. To cover the two bands of WLAN (i.e., lower band of 2.4 GHz and upper bands of 5 GHz), two monopoles are used: one working for the lower band and the other working for the higher band. However, there is a limit in most of these antennas to obtain the wideband characteristic especially at the 5-GHz band for WLAN applications, when operating simultaneously at 2.4 GHz. The proposed antenna achieves a good bandwidth at the upper frequency, the data rate has been increased with the help of MIMO configuration. The simulated results are giving a very good return loss of -22.14 dB for 2.4 GHz band and -35.43 dB for 5.0 GHz for the single antenna.
